Sylvania Type 1B3GT
HV HALF-WAVE RECTIFIER



MECHANICAL DATA

Bulb T-9
Base1 B5-82
B5-85 Short Intermediate Shell Octal 5-Pin
B6-8 Intermediate Shell Octal 6-Pin
B6-60 Short Intermediate Shell Octal 6-Pin
B7-47 Short Intermediate Shell Octal 7-Pin
B7-166 Intermediate Shell Octal 7-Pin
Cap C1-34
Outline 9-51
9-52
Basing2 3C
Cathode Coated Filament
Mounting Position Any


ELECTRICAL DATA


FILAMENT CHARACTERISTICS
Filament Voltage3 1.25 Volts
Filament Current 200 Ma

DIRECT INTERELCTRODE CAPACITANCES (Approx.).
Plate to Filament and Internal Shield 1.3 ��f

MAXIMUM RATINGS (Design-Center Values -- Except as Noted)
Flyback Voltage Rectifier4
Inverse Plate Voltage Total DC & Peak (Absolute Value) 26,000 Volts
Inverse Plate Voltage DC 21,000 Volts
Peak Plate Current 50 Ma
Average Plate Current 0.5 Ma
R F Voltage Rectifier
Peak-Inverse Plate Voltage (Absolute Value) 33,000 Volts
Peak Plate Current 30 Ma
Average Plate Current 1.0 Ma
Minimum Frequency of Supply Voltage 1.5 Kc
Maximum Frequency of Supply Voltage 100 Kc

CHARACTERISTICS
Tube Drop for Ib = 7 Ma (approx.) 100 Volts

NOTES:

1 On the 5-Pin bases, Pin 1 is omitted
On the 5, 6 and 7-Pin bases JETEC B7-166, Pin 4 is Omitted
On the 5, 6 and 7-Pin bases JETEC B7-47, Pin 6 is Omitted
2 Socket Terminals 1, 3, 4, 5, 6 and 8 may be connected to terminal 7 or to a corona shield which connects to terminal 7. Terminals 4 and 6 may be used as tie points for components at or near filament potential.
3 Under no circumstances should the filament voltage be less than 1.05 volts or more than 1.45 volts.
4 For operation in a 525-line, 30-frame system as described in "Standards of Good Engineering Practice for Television Broadcast Stations; Federal Communications Commission," the duty cycle of the voltage pulse must not exceed 15% of one scanning cycle.

APPLICATION

The Sylvania Type 1G3GT is a filamentary half-wave diode intended for service as high voltage rectifiers in television receivers and other high voltage rectifier applications.


WARNING

X-ray radiation shield may be necessary to protect against possible danger of personal injury from prolonged exposure at close range if this tube is operated at higher than the manufacturers Maximum Rate Plate Voltage, or 16,000 volts, whichever is less.
